About me
Dr. Jessica Kim is a gynecologist and minimally invasive gynecologic surgeon who cares for patients with endometriosis, chronic pelvic pain, fibroids, ovarian cysts, abnormal bleeding and other gynecologic conditions. She has advanced training in laparoscopic and robotic surgical techniques for treating complex disorders, including an enlarged uterus, large pelvic masses and endometriosis. Kim's research interests include surgical and patient education. She utilizes videography and digital animation to teach medical students about pelvic anatomy and to help patients understand their conditions – some of her work can be seen at her Instagram page. She is also passionate about using surgical simulation to help trainees improve their skills. Kim earned her medical degree and completed a residency in obstetrics and gynecology at UCSF. She completed a fellowship in minimally invasive gynecologic surgery at Beth Israel Lahey Health.

For informational purposes only, a link to the federal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) Open Payments web page is provided here. The federal Physician Payments Sunshine Act requires that detailed information about payment and other payments of value worth over ten dollars ($10) from manufacturers of drugs, medical devices, and biologics to physicians and teaching hospitals be made available to the public.
